Output 3ac4aa7edc55780798513630e04bda383fd6ea9aa623e6d95b77bd852e069037:1

value
1523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35d2f63f391ae1bdebf3ac9206b9db3bc4ecd4d8 OP_EQUAL
address
36bcTbo1jA7DPW5oAbtLLfEoDHZmLFkkkL
transaction
3ac4aa7edc55780798513630e04bda383fd6ea9aa623e6d95b77bd852e069037
spent
true